comparison lisp/mule/cyrillic-hooks.el @ 138:6608ceec7cf8 r20-2b3

Import from CVS: tag r20-2b3
author cvs
date Mon, 13 Aug 2007 09:31:46 +0200
parents fe104dbd9147
children 3bb7ccffb0c0
comparison
equal deleted inserted replaced
137:cae984061f40 138:6608ceec7cf8
23 23
24 ;;; Synched up with: Mule 2.3. 24 ;;; Synched up with: Mule 2.3.
25 25
26 ;; For syntax of Cyrillic 26 ;; For syntax of Cyrillic
27 (modify-syntax-entry 'cyrillic-iso8859-5 "w") 27 (modify-syntax-entry 'cyrillic-iso8859-5 "w")
28 (modify-syntax-entry ?,L-(B ".") 28 (modify-syntax-entry ?-L­ ".")-A
29 (modify-syntax-entry ?,Lp(B ".") 29 (modify-syntax-entry ?-Lð ".")-A
30 (modify-syntax-entry ?,L}(B ".") 30 (modify-syntax-entry ?-Lý ".")-A
31 31
32 32
33 33
34 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;; 34 ;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;
35 ;;; CYRILLIC 35 ;;; CYRILLIC
43 charset-g2 t 43 charset-g2 t
44 charset-g3 t 44 charset-g3 t
45 mnemonic "ISO8/Cyr" 45 mnemonic "ISO8/Cyr"
46 )) 46 ))
47 47
48 ;;(add-hook 'quail-package-alist '("jcuken" "quail/cyrillic")) 48 ;;(add-hook 'quail-package-alist '("jcuken" "quail-cyrillic"))
49 ;;(add-hook 'quail-package-alist '("macedonian" "quail/cyrillic")) 49 ;;(add-hook 'quail-package-alist '("macedonian" "quail-cyrillic"))
50 ;;(add-hook 'quail-package-alist '("serbian" "quail/cyrillic")) 50 ;;(add-hook 'quail-package-alist '("serbian" "quail-cyrillic"))
51 ;;(add-hook 'quail-package-alist '("beylorussian" "quail/cyrillic")) 51 ;;(add-hook 'quail-package-alist '("beylorussian" "quail-cyrillic"))
52 ;;(add-hook 'quail-package-alist '("ukrainian" "quail/cyrillic")) 52 ;;(add-hook 'quail-package-alist '("ukrainian" "quail-cyrillic"))
53 ;;(add-hook 'quail-package-alist '("yawerty" "quail/cyrillic")) 53 (add-hook 'quail-package-alist '("yawerty" "quail-cyrillic"))
54 54
55 (define-language-environment 'cyrillic 55 (define-language-environment 'cyrillic
56 "Cyrillic" 56 "Cyrillic"
57 (lambda () 57 (lambda ()
58 (set-coding-category-system 'iso-8-designate 'iso-8859-5) 58 (set-coding-category-system 'iso-8-designate 'iso-8859-5)
59 (set-coding-priority-list '(iso-8-designate iso-8-1)) 59 (set-coding-priority-list '(iso-8-designate iso-8-1))
60 (set-default-buffer-file-coding-system 'iso-8859-5) 60 (set-default-buffer-file-coding-system 'iso-8859-5)
61 (setq terminal-coding-system 'iso-8859-5) 61 (setq terminal-coding-system 'iso-8859-5)
62 (setq keyboard-coding-system 'iso-8859-5) 62 (setq keyboard-coding-system 'iso-8859-5)
63 ;; (setq-default quail-current-package 63 (setq-default quail-current-package
64 ;; (assoc "yawerty" quail-package-alist)))) 64 (assoc "yawerty" quail-package-alist))
65 )) 65 ))